Seek out the Secor Cairn, a striking 1938 stone monument quietly standing in Scarborough that brings together twelve historic gravestones, most belonging to the Secor family, with roots reaching back to 1819. Erected in honour of Peter Secor — the very first Reeve of Scarborough Township — it's a rare open-air history lesson hiding in plain sight.
